  8. If you participated in the Cakewalk account migration in late 2014 through Oct. 2017 support@cakewalk.com can restore access to the account. If you did not create an account at that time and did not write down the registration code provided when MC5 was first registered, activating MC5 is going to be a problem. Cakewalk by BandLab (CbB) can read MC files but it may not load all the plug-ins. Note: CbB is not the same as the DAW called BandLab. MC5 was a 32bit DAW and if there are any 32bit DX plug-ins referenced in the projects that do not have 64bit versions included with CbB, the 32bit DX plug-ins will not load.

  20. In order to change ASIO drivers the current input and output devices must be deselected before making a new selection. ASIO mode works with one i/O driver at a time. May want to uninstall ASIO4All and use the Presonus driver exclusively.
